About the Role: We are currently seeking a Building Support Service Specialist to support our federal customers in the US Virgin Islands. This position serves as the support to federal field office managers, and is integral in providing general building management, construction management, and project management services.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Serves as the on-site point of contact (POC) during construction projects, and when interacting with federal client agency personnel.
  • Performs property management and inspections services of federally owned facilities.
  • Oversees repair and alterations projects in federally supervised owned locations within the Field Office.
  • Sets up meetings with the construction and building maintenance contractors.
  • Performs periodic budget and other reviews on behalf of federal customers.
  • Prepares reports, documents, and letters for the review and signature of the building manager.
  • Performs mechanical/janitorial inspections in machine rooms, roofs, or other construction sites.
  • Meets with building tenants on a recurring basis to assess their facility needs, ensure that those needs are being met or exceeded, and assure that the procedures used to obtain services are responsive and customer-friendly.
  • Assists with estimating projects for construction and services in federally owned space in accordance with federal requirements.
  • Manages all assigned projects from “cradle to grave”, inputting everything from the estimates and scopes of work to the financial documents for contract award and closeout.
  • Ensures that all building maintenance services are properly scheduled with the client agency and building owner and proper funding is in place.
  • Advises on dangerous conditions, accidents, and any other safety conditions requiring immediate action.
  • Coordinates, and is present for, after-hours inspections such as Fire Alarm and Elevator inspections as needed.

Qualifications:

Your Skills & Education:

  • Minimum of five (5) years’ work experience in managing commercial or residential buildings.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ple projects in design and construction on budget and on schedule.
  • Demonstrated ability to effectively administer and manage large or diverse collections of owned properties.
  • Possesses superior customer service skills and acts in a manner that is professional and businesslike when interacting with visitors, contractors, and federal personnel.
  • Possesses excellent accounting and organizational skills.
  • Possesses knowledge of National, State, and Local laws and codes.
  • Must be able to obtain HSPD-12 federal security clearance. (Mandatory Requirement)
